Conversion: Xml, Text, JavaObj
The following table illustrates the API method for converting lexical record(s) between text, Xml, Java Objects, and inflection variables:
| Source | Target | API methods |
|---|---|---|
| Api.ToJavaObjApi | ||
| lexRecord, String/text | lexRecord, Java Object | ToJavaObjApi.ToJavaObjFromText(String) |
| lexRecord, String/text | lexRecord, Java Object | ToJavaObjApi.ToJavaObjsFromText(String) |
| lexRecord, File/text | lexRecord, Java Object | ToJavaObjApi.ToJavaObjsFromTextFile(String) |
| lexRecord, File/Xml | lexRecord, Java Object | ToJavaObjApi.ToJavaObjsFromXmlFile(String) |
| Api.ToXmljApi | ||
| lexRecord, String/text | lexRecord, Xml | ToXmlApi.ToXmlFromText(String) |
| lexRecord, File/text | lexRecord, Xml | ToXmlApi.ToXmlFromTextFile(String) |
| Api.ToInflVarsApi | ||
| lexRecord, File/text | inflVars, String | ToInflVarsApi.GetInflVarsFromTextFile(String) |
| Lib.LexRecord | ||
| lexRecord, Java Object | lexRecord, String/text | LexRecord.GetText( ) |
| lexRecord, Java Object | lexRecord, String/Xml | LexRecord.GetXml( ) |
| lexRecord, Java Object | inflVars, String | LexRecord.GetInflectionalVars( ) |